Dress for Success for Interviews

First impressions are formed before you speak. In her article for SCMP Young Post, May Chan of Spark Image Consultancy outlines how thoughtful dress choices can support confidence and credibility in job and university interviews.

The guidance focuses on clarity and appropriateness: choose clothing that fits well, reflects the role or institution you are applying to, and avoids distracting details. Colour, proportion and grooming all contribute to an overall impression of competence and care. Practical tips include selecting neutral or muted tones for conservative settings, ensuring garments are well-pressed, and balancing personal style with professional expectations.

Beyond clothing, nonverbal cues such as posture, eye contact and a calm demeanor reinforce the message your appearance sends. Dressing intentionally is not about hiding individuality but about presenting a composed, respectful version of yourself that aligns with the context of the interview.
